Nexstar Chief Technology and Digital Officer Brett Jenkins retires Oct. 1, shifts to executive advisor
NXST•Jenkins to retire from full-time role and become executive advisor
Nexstar Media Group said EVP, chief technology and digital officer Brett Jenkins will retire from full-time work effective Oct. 1.
Jenkins will shift to executive advisor, providing counsel to CEO Perry Sook and COO Michael Biard while overseeing special projects.
He joined Nexstar as chief technology officer in 2017 following its acquisition of Media General.
Before Nexstar, Jenkins served as Media General’s vice president and chief technology officer from 2014 to 2017.
He will remain involved with Edgebeam Wireless, a wireless data services venture launched in 2025 by Nexstar and other broadcasters.
